What is Gbps?
Gigabits per second (Gbps) represents extremely high-speed data transfers at 1,000,000,000 bits per second following international decimal standards.
Common uses:
- Data center interconnects
- High-performance computing
- Fiber optic network backbone
- 5G network infrastructure
What is bps?
Bits per second (bps) is the fundamental unit of data transfer rate, representing the number of bits transmitted or received per second.
Common uses:
- Measuring very low-speed connections
- Basic telecommunication systems
- Serial communication protocols
- Fundamental network speed calculations
Gbps vs bps
1 Gbps equals 1,000,000,000 bps. Gigabits per second is a larger unit than bits per second, making it suitable for measuring higher data transfer rates.

How to Convert Gbps to bps
Formula:
Gbps × 1000000000 = bps
Example:
Example: 1 Gbps × 1000000000 = 1000000000 bps
How to Convert bps to Gbps
Formula:
bps ÷ 1000000000 = Gbps
Example:
Example: 1000000000 bps ÷ 1000000000 = 1 Gbps
